Overview

The LG S20A 2.0 ch. Soundbar is a compact, affordable sound solution designed to elevate your TV's audio performance. This sleek soundbar delivers Dolby Audio and DTS Digital Surround, offering clear, immersive sound for all your media. Thanks to its simple setup, the S20A is perfect for those who want an easy audio upgrade. With its easy connectivity options like HDMI ARC and Bluetooth, it provides a hassle-free connection to your TV and other devices, making it ideal for those seeking quality sound without the complexity.

Features & Benefits

The S20A comes with a range of features that enhance your listening experience. Its AI Sound Pro adjusts audio automatically for clear vocals, deep bass, and dynamic action scenes. Integration with LG TVs is seamless, thanks to the WOW Orchestra and WOW Interface, which allow you to control both your TV and soundbar with a single remote. The soundbar is designed for easy installation, offering a one-cord HDMI ARC connection for quick setup. Additionally, the metal grill adds durability and a modern touch to its compact design.

User Feedback

User feedback on the S20A has been generally positive, with many praising its sound quality and ease of setup. Reviewers have noted that it significantly enhances the TV audio experience, especially for those using it with LG TVs, as the integration is seamless. Some users, however, mentioned that the bass might not be deep enough for larger rooms or more powerful sound demands. Overall, the soundbar is favored for its affordability and user-friendly design, although a few wish for more bass or a dedicated subwoofer in larger spaces.

Specifications

  • Audio Channels: This soundbar features a 2.0 channel configuration, providing stereo sound for clear, dynamic audio.
  • Connectivity: Supports HDMI ARC, Bluetooth, and Wi-Fi for flexible connections to a range of devices.
  • Audio Technologies: Equipped with Dolby Audio and DTS Digital Surround for an enhanced surround sound experience.
  • Special Features: Includes AI Sound Pro for automatic sound adjustments based on the content being played.
  • Design: Compact design with a durable metal grill, making it both portable and stylish.
  • Dimensions: Measures 25.6″ x 2.5″ x 3.9″ (WxHxD), fitting easily under most TVs or on tabletop spaces.
  • Weight: Weighs 4.9 lbs, offering a lightweight form factor for easy handling and placement.
  • Impedance: The soundbar has an impedance of 60 Ohm, ensuring proper power handling and performance.
  • Compatibility: Compatible with LG TVs 32 inches and up, offering seamless integration for optimal performance.
  • Mounting Type: Designed for tabletop placement, with no additional mounting accessories required.
  • Surround Sound Mode: Supports surround sound mode for a more immersive viewing experience, enhancing audio depth.
  • Setup: One-cord HDMI ARC setup ensures simple installation and easy connection to your TV.
  • Control Integration: Fully integrates with LG TVs, allowing control of both the TV and soundbar using a single remote.
